Robert Plant’s Saving Grace is the first album featuring a new band of distinguished players, which he calls “a song book of the lost and found”. The genesis of Saving Grace began during the lockdown in “The Shire”, when Plant’s customary wandering was all but forbidden. BBM (Baker Bruce Moore) was a short-lived super group consisting of Ginger Baker and Jack Bruce (Cream) and Gary Moore. As a power trio (a group consisting of one electric guitarist, one bass player and one drummer) they released just one album, Around the Next Dream. The Bela Session is UK post-punk pioneers Bauhaus’ debut studio recording made in 1979.
